Manufactured circa 1862-1868. This revolver is chambered for the 30 caliber cup primed front loading cartridge. The top of the barrel rib is marked "MERWIN & BRAY FIRE ARMS CO. N.Y.", with patent dates marked around the five round cylinder. The matching serial number is marked on the butt, rear face of the cylinder, stamped on the inside of the right grip panel and on the bottom barrel flat. Silver plated brass frame, with blue remaining parts, blade front and frame notch rear sights, spur trigger and fitted with smooth varnished two-piece walnut grips. Comes with an original two-piece box with a black and yellow mottled appearance and "DIRECTIONS FOR USING" label on the inside of the lid.

Condition: Fine. The barrel shows 30% original blue finish, which is mostly contained in the protected areas, with a smooth brown patina on the balance. The cylinder has a smooth brown patina with scattered traces of original blue finish. The frame retains 98% original silver plating, which has darkened with age, and shows some pin prick blistering. The grips are excellent with 98% original varnish, showing some very minor lower edge wear and a couple very minor dings and handling marks. The markings are clear. The action is excellent. The box is very fine.
